SENATOR LALONG ADMONISHES YOUNG GOLFERS; TEES-OFF JUNIOR GOLF TOURNAMENT AT RAYFIELD CLUB

Senator representing Plateau South Senatorial District Simon Bako Lalong has admonished young golfers to dedicate themselves to learning the game and its ethics as it has potential to making them world champions.

Senator Lalong was speaking at the opening of the 1st Rayfield Junior Open Golf Championship holding at the Rayfield Golf Club Jos.

He said the game of golf is not only for sport and leisure, but has tourism and business opportunities which come with a lot of financial benefits.

Lalong who is an avid Golfer and a promoter of the sport in Plateau State and Nigeria at large, said those who start the game at a younger age can make reap its fruits more elaborately if they concentrate in learning its ethics and principles.

He commended the organisers and said he will continue to support and encourage such Championships which are for talent discovery and grooming.

Senator Lalong announced prizes for the first three winners.

Secretary to the Government of Plateau State Arch. Samuel Jatau said the administration of Governor Caleb Mutfwang places importance on sports development with emphasis on catching young sportsmen and women from the grassroots.

He emphasized that Plateau State is the home of golf and tourism which will be encouraged and supported by the government to ensure that the game is not only nurtured, but produces global icons.

The SGS appreciated the former Governor of Plateau State Senator Lalong for his passion for the game and urged other citizens to support sports development and youth activities.
